Why Twitter and Radio Create Powerful UK Marketing Synergies

The relationship between Twitter advertising UK campaigns and radio broadcasting stems from complementary audience behaviors. Radio listeners in the UK spend an average of 21.5 hours weekly with broadcast audio, according to RAJAR data, while simultaneously maintaining active social media presences. This dual engagement creates natural touchpoint opportunities that smart advertisers exploit.

Radio drives immediate Twitter activity. Research from Radiocentre demonstrates that 42% of UK radio advertising listeners access social media while listening, creating real-time conversation opportunities around broadcast content. When brands synchronize Twitter advertising UK efforts with radio spots, they tap into audiences already primed for engagement. A financial services brand recently combined drive-time radio spots on commercial stations with targeted Twitter campaigns, achieving 63% lower cost-per-engagement than Twitter-only campaigns by leveraging radio's audience priming effect.

The demographic alignment strengthens this synergy. Commercial radio in the UK reaches 89% of adults weekly, with particular strength among the 25-44 demographic that also represents Twitter's core UK user base. Strategic Approaches to Twitter Advertising UK and Radio Integration

Successful integration requires more than simultaneous channel deployment. The most effective strategies create genuine synergy between radio's storytelling capacity and Twitter's engagement mechanics.

Hashtag campaigns paired with radio mentions generate measurable lift. When radio spots include specific hashtags that Twitter advertising UK campaigns then amplify, brands create

unified conversation threads. A retail brand launching autumn promotions used this approach, embedding a campaign hashtag in 30-second radio spots across regional UK stations while running promoted tweets featuring the same hashtag. The result was a 340% increase in organic hashtag usage compared to Twitter-only test markets, with Media.co.uk reporting cost efficiencies of 28% through coordinated media buying across both channels.

Sequential messaging frameworks leverage each medium's strengths. Radio excels at narrative establishment and emotional connection, while Twitter advertising UK campaigns drive specific actions and continued conversation. Entertainment brands frequently use radio to build anticipation for releases, then deploy Twitter campaigns with booking links, trailers, and interactive content. This sequence capitalizes on radio's broad reach for awareness while using Twitter's targeting capabilities for conversion-focused messaging.

Geographic targeting creates localized impact at scale. Regional radio stations deliver concentrated audience attention in specific UK markets, which Twitter advertising UK campaigns can mirror through geographic targeting parameters. A restaurant chain expanding across the Midlands combined advertising on regional stations like Heart West Midlands with Twitter campaigns geo-targeted to Birmingham, Coventry, and surrounding areas. Audience Demographics and Cross-Platform Reach Considerations

Understanding audience composition across both channels informs smarter allocation decisions. UK radio delivers particularly strong performance among older demographics, with commercial radio reaching 91% of adults aged 45-54. Meanwhile, Twitter's UK user base skews younger but includes substantial professional audiences, with 39% of UK Twitter users aged 25-44 representing decision-makers and household purchasers.

This demographic distribution creates opportunities for complete funnel coverage. Brands targeting broad UK audiences benefit from radio's comprehensive reach while using Twitter advertising UK campaigns to engage specific segments with tailored messaging. Financial services advertisers frequently employ this approach, using radio for brand building across all ages while deploying Twitter campaigns with product-specific messages for digitally active segments.

Peak engagement times differ meaningfully between channels, enabling extended campaign presence. Radio audiences peak during morning drive time (6-9am) and afternoon drive (4-7pm), while Twitter engagement in the UK sustains throughout working hours with particular strength during lunch periods and evening hours. Tactical Execution | Timing, Creative, and Measurement Frameworks

Campaign timing coordination maximizes cross-channel amplification. The most effective approaches synchronize radio flight dates with Twitter advertising UK campaign periods, creating concentrated presence that drives message frequency. However, sophisticated advertisers also deploy sequential patterns, using radio to establish awareness before Twitter campaigns promote specific offers or events.

Creative consistency with platform-appropriate adaptation delivers strongest results. Successful campaigns maintain consistent brand voice, key messages, and calls-to-action across radio and Twitter while adapting creative execution to each medium's format. Radio spots emphasize audio branding and narrative storytelling, while Twitter advertising UK creative prioritizes visual impact and immediate comprehension. A travel brand achieved 41% higher campaign recall by maintaining consistent destination messaging while creating platform-specific creative assets, with radio spots featuring soundscapes and Twitter ads showcasing destination imagery.

Measurement frameworks must capture both individual channel performance and cross-channel lift. Implementing unique promotional codes or landing pages for each channel enables attribution, while brand tracking studies reveal synergistic effects. Cost Efficiency and ROI Optimization in Integrated Campaigns

Budget allocation between radio and Twitter advertising UK requires strategic consideration of relative costs and performance characteristics. Radio advertising costs in the UK vary substantially by station, daypart, and market, with 30-second spots on national commercial stations ranging from hundreds to thousands of pounds depending on timing and placement. Twitter advertising operates on auction-based pricing, with UK costs per engagement typically ranging from £0.50 to £3.00 depending on targeting parameters and competition.

Integrated campaigns often achieve better overall efficiency than channel-focused approaches. When radio drives social conversation and search activity, Twitter advertising UK campaigns benefit from heightened relevance scores and lower competition for audience attention,
